FAQ

What should I look for when choosing a light switch wall plate cover?

Start with three checks: device type (toggle, rocker/Decora, or blank), gang count (how many switches share the box), and color/finish that matches nearby trim. Then consider material: basic plastic is inexpensive and easy to clean; metal adds rigidity and a different look; screwless designs hide hardware. Verify screw spacing and opening size match your switch, and avoid oversized plates unless you need to cover paint lines.

How much should I spend, and is there real value in paying more?

For a standard single‑gang plastic plate, expect roughly $1–$5 each, with multipacks lowering the per‑plate cost. Paying more makes sense for screwless designs, metal finishes, impact‑resistant materials, or matching specialty devices. If you’re replacing many plates in one room, consistency often matters more than premium materials. For rentals and utility areas, reliable plastic plates are usually the best value.

Will a 1‑gang toggle wallplate fit my setup?

Confirm the switch is a narrow “toggle” style and that only one device occupies the box (1‑gang). Check the box is not wider (2‑ or 3‑gang) and that no dimmer faceplate or rocker is installed. Measure visually: the opening should match the thin toggle lever. Decision tip: when in doubt, compare your switch to product photos of “toggle” versus “rocker” to avoid the wrong style.

When should I choose a simple toggle plate instead of Decora or screwless covers?

Choose a toggle plate when your switches are classic toggle levers or when you want easy, low‑cost replacements that match older hardware. Pick Decora plates when your devices are rocker switches, smart controls, or GFCI outlets that share the same rectangular opening. Choose screwless if you want a cleaner look and don’t mind paying more. Keep one style consistent within a room.

How do I tighten a loose light switch wall plate without cracking it?

Loosen both screws, square the plate, then hand‑start each screw. Using a screwdriver (not a drill), snug the top screw until it just stops, then give it a tiny 1/8–1/4 turn. Repeat on the bottom. If the plate still wobbles, add a thin shim/spacer behind it or ensure the switch yoke is firmly attached to the box. Do not overtighten—plastic can crack.
